Title: DIFFERENCE/INDIFFERENCE
MUSINGS ON POSTMODERNISM, MARCEL DUCHAMP AND JOHN CAGE
By: Moira Roth, Jonathan D. Katz

Description: This text brings together Moira Roth's articles, lectures and interviews on two men who embodied the spirit of the avant-garde - Marcel Duchamp and John Cage. With their gradual transformation into "classical" figures, Roth aims to reconsider and re-evaluate them.
